2025年计算机考研模拟题库_第1页
2025年计算机考研模拟题库_第2页
2025年计算机考研模拟题库_第3页
2025年计算机考研模拟题库_第4页
2025年计算机考研模拟题库_第5页
已阅读5页,还剩3页未读 继续免费阅读

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2025年计算机考研模拟题库考试时间:______分钟总分:______分姓名:______一、单项选择题(每小题2分,共20分。下列每小题给出的四个选项中,只有一项是符合题目要求的。请将正确选项前的字母填在答题卡相应位置。)1.计算机系统层次结构中,位于最底层,直接面向硬件的是()。A.操作系统B.微程序处理器C.应用软件D.汇编语言2.若某数的原码表示为1001,则其对应的补码表示为()。A.1001B.0111C.1101D.01103.在下列进程状态转换中,不可能直接发生的是()。A.运行态->就绪态B.就绪态->运行态C.运行态->停止态D.停止态->运行态4.采用分页存储管理方式时,地址变换需要经过()。A.逻辑地址到物理地址的映射B.物理地址到逻辑地址的映射C.段号到页号的映射D.页号到块号的映射5.在TCP/IP网络协议中,负责将IP数据报从源主机路由到目的主机的层是()。A.应用层B.传输层C.网络层D.数据链路层6.下列关于数据结构的叙述中,正确的是()。A.栈是一种先进先出(FIFO)的数据结构B.队列是一种后进先出(LIFO)的数据结构C.在线性表中,每个元素都有一个直接前驱和一个直接后继D.二叉树是一种非线性结构,它的每个节点都有两个子节点7.对于线性表,若采用链式存储结构,则在删除一个元素时,需要进行的操作是()。A.仅修改头指针B.仅修改尾指针C.找到该元素的前驱节点并修改其指针D.找到该元素的所有后继节点并修改它们的指针8.在下列算法中,时间复杂度不可能为O(1)的是()。A.访问数组中第i个元素B.在有序数组中查找一个不存在的元素(使用二分查找)C.访问链表中第i个元素(假设已知头指针)D.访问哈希表中存储的关键字9.下列关于指令系统的叙述中,正确的是()。A.指令的格式是固定不变的B.寻址方式越多,指令的功能越强C.指令系统与具体的计算机硬件结构无关D.指令长度总是等于机器字长10.采用CSMA/CD介质访问控制方法的总线型网络,当两个节点同时发送数据时,将发生冲突。冲突后,一个胜出节点继续发送,另一个失败节点需要等待一个随机时间后才能重新尝试发送,这种现象体现了()。A.优先级原则B.冲突检测与解决机制C.令牌传递机制D.时隙分配机制二、填空题(每空2分,共30分。请将答案填写在答题卡相应位置。)1.计算机硬件能自动执行的、最基本操作的逻辑单元是______。2.在二叉树中,若某节点的度为2,则称该节点为______节点。3.为了解决内存碎片问题,常采用______存储管理技术。4.操作系统通过______机制,实现不同进程之间的通信与同步。5.在TCP/IP协议簇中,负责数据包传输的协议是______。6.在队列中,插入元素的一端称为______端,删除元素的一端称为______端。7.数据的______是计算机能够识别和处理的唯一形式。8.计算机网络按照覆盖范围可以分为局域网(LAN)和______。9.假定某计算机的存储器地址空间为16位,则其可直接访问的内存空间大小为______字节。10.计算机网络体系结构中,OSI模型的最高层是______层。11.若一个循环队列的队头指针为H,队尾指针为T,队列的最大容量为MaxSize,则队列为空的条件是______。12.程序设计语言中的函数是为了实现______而引入的。13.CPU执行指令的过程通常包括取指、译码和______三个主要阶段。14.网桥工作在网络的______层。15.衡量算法效率的两个主要指标是时间复杂度和______。三、简答题(每小题5分,共20分。请将答案填写在答题卡相应位置。)1.简述中断和异常的区别。2.简述冒泡排序算法的基本思想。3.简述TCP协议与UDP协议的主要区别。4.简述文件系统实现文件共享的一般方法。四、算法设计题(10分。请将答案填写在答题卡相应位置。)设计一个算法,找出顺序存储的线性表(数组A,长度为n)中的最大元素及其所在位置(位置从1开始编号)。要求:写出算法的基本思想,并用pseudocode或C/C++伪代码描述该算法。五、分析题(20分。请将答案填写在答题卡相应位置。)假设有一个采用页式存储管理的计算机系统,页面大小为1KB。某进程的页表如下(页号从0开始编号):|页号(PageNo.)|裸页框号(FrameNo.)||:|:||0|3||1|1||2|-1||3|4||4|0||...|...|其中,“-1”表示该页页框尚未分配(处于空闲状态)。假设该进程要访问逻辑地址为2000H的内存单元,请通过页表查找,回答以下问题:1.该逻辑地址对应的页号是多少?帧号是多少?2.系统将如何处理该访问请求?(例如,是否会发生缺页中断?若发生,缺页中断处理后,该页的页表项内容会发生什么变化?假设缺页中断处理后,将该页调入帧号为2的页框。)3.如果该进程随后要访问逻辑地址为3000H的内存单元,请问这次访问是否会发生缺页中断?为什么?试卷答案一、单项选择题1.B2.C3.D4.A5.C6.D7.C8.C9.B10.B二、填空题1.运算器2.恢复3.分页4.信号量5.IP6.队尾队头7.编码8.广域网(WAN)9.64K10.应用11.H==T12.模块化13.执行14.二15.空间复杂度三、简答题1.异常是由正在执行的程序内部产生的,通常是由于程序错误(如除零错误)或非法操作引起的,中断则是由外部事件(如I/O完成、硬件故障)或内部中断指令(如访管指令)引发的。2.冒泡排序的基本思想是:通过n-1轮比较和交换,将线性表中的元素逐个“冒泡”到其最终位置。每一轮中,相邻元素进行比较,若顺序错误则交换,使得每一轮后,线性表末尾部分的最大元素被“冒”到其正确的位置。3.TCP是面向连接的、可靠的、基于字节流的传输层协议,提供全双工通信,确保数据按序、无差错传输。UDP是无连接的、不可靠的、基于数据报的传输层协议,传输速度快,但不对数据报进行序号、差错校验等,可能出现丢包、乱序。4.文件系统实现文件共享通常通过以下方法:为需要共享的文件创建一个共享文件集(如NTFS的共享名),设置适当的共享权限;将共享文件集映射到网络上的其他计算机,形成网络共享资源;网络上的用户通过访问网络路径或UNC名称来访问共享文件。四、算法设计题算法基本思想:初始化最大元素值为第一个元素,最大元素位置为1。从头到尾遍历数组,依次比较当前元素与已记录的最大元素值,若当前元素更大,则更新最大元素值及其位置。Pseudocode:```MAX_ELEMENT(A,n)max_value=A[1]max_position=1fori=2tondoifA[i]>max_valuethenmax_value=A[i]max_position=iendifendforreturn(max_value,max_position)end```五、分析题1.逻辑地址2000H对应的页号为2000H/1000H=2,帧号为页表[2]=-1。2.会发生缺页中断,因为页表项[2]的帧号为-1,表示页框未分配。缺页中断

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论